The victims of the punitive operation of the Ukrainian occupying forces in Donbass in 2019 were 145 civilians.
This is evidenced by the data of the OSCE Special Monitoring Mission.
“Since the beginning of 2019, the Special Monitoring Mission confirmed 145 civilian casualties: 18 dead, 127 wounded”, – the report says.
At the same time it is noted that over the past year the number of civilian casualties has significantly decreased. Thus, in 2018, 43 civilians were killed in Donbas, while 179 more were injured.
It should be noted that the UN data slightly differ from the OSCE statistics. In the first half of December, the UN human rights mission in Ukraine reported 26 dead civilians and 130 injured.
